C++ Software Engineer

2 weeks ago


New York, New York, United States QUANTEAM - North America (RAINBOW PARTNERS Group) Full time

Company Overview

As a pioneering entity within RAINBOW PARTNERS, Quanteam is a consultancy firm dedicated to the domains of Banking, Finance, and Financial Services. Our ethos is rooted in values such as collaboration, diversity, and excellence, and we boast a team of 1,000 skilled consultants from 35 nationalities, operating across 10 global offices.

Position Overview

Our client is in search of a proficient C++ low latency developer to enhance their thriving, fully automated trading operations across various asset classes.

This role is integral to the complete development lifecycle, encompassing everything from gathering requirements to final implementation, along with ongoing support for internal stakeholders. The ideal candidate will collaborate with a team of highly skilled engineers to improve the functionality and efficiency of the company’s advanced trading system, which handles substantial trading volumes.

Key Responsibilities

  • Design and develop innovative market connectivity solutions.
  • Collaborate closely with algorithm developers and traders to address diverse requirements.
  • Ensure that order management aligns with optimal execution standards.
  • Engage continuously with colleagues and business leaders to foster skill enhancement.

Required Skills

  • Proven experience with C/C++, including knowledge of C++17 and templates.
  • Expertise in low latency programming, performance optimization, and debugging.
  • Familiarity with FIX and Binary Connectivity Protocols.
  • Proficient in network protocols such as TCP and multicast.
  • FPGA knowledge is advantageous for understanding socket operations.
  • Experience with Market Data feed handlers and Client/Market Connectivity solutions.
  • Understanding of investment management processes and trading execution systems.
  • Experience in Linux development environments.
  • Proficiency in Python scripting or equivalent languages.
  • Excellent communication skills are essential.

Preferred Qualifications and Education

  • Advanced degree in Mathematics or Computer Science (MSc/Ph.D.).
  • A collaborative team player capable of creating robust software components.
  • Experience in analyzing and structuring large datasets.
  • Knowledge of trading practices and market microstructure.

  • C++ Software Engineer

    2 weeks ago


    New York, New York, United States Open Systems Technologies Full time

    C++ Software Engineer at Open Systems Technologies Compensation: $200-300k/year We are seeking a skilled software engineer to contribute to the architecture, design, and implementation of high-performance C++ systems. Key ResponsibilitiesCollaborating with both hardware and software engineers to develop ultra-low latency trading solutionsDesigning and...

  • C# Software Engineer

    2 weeks ago


    New York, New York, United States Georgia IT Inc Full time

    Position - C# Software Engineer Location - Remote Duration - Full time Compensation - Competitive salary plus benefits Job OverviewWe are seeking a skilled C# Software Engineer to join our dynamic team at Georgia IT Inc. The ideal candidate will possess a robust understanding of software development principles and a passion for creating innovative...


  • New York, New York, United States Open Systems Technologies Full time

    Job DescriptionCompany: Open Systems TechnologiesJob Title: Senior C++ Software EngineerJob Summary:We are seeking a highly skilled Senior C++ Software Engineer to join our team in New York, NY. As a key member of our development team, you will be responsible for designing, developing, and maintaining complex software systems using C++.Key...

  • C# Software Engineer

    2 weeks ago


    New York, New York, United States Five Cubes, Inc. Full time

    Job Title: C# Software Engineer Company: Five Cubes, Inc. Location: Remote Duration: Long-term Contract Job Overview: We are seeking a skilled C# Software Engineer to join our dynamic team. The ideal candidate will be responsible for developing innovative solutions and enhancing existing applications. Key Responsibilities: Design and implement new workflows...

  • C++ Software Engineer

    2 weeks ago


    New York, New York, United States Diverse Lynx Full time

    Job Overview We are seeking a C++ Software Engineer with a strong foundation in programming and a deep understanding of object-oriented design principles. The ideal candidate will have: Proficiency in C++: Demonstrated experience in developing robust applications using C++. Java Frameworks: Familiarity with frameworks such as DropWizard, Spring,...

  • C# Software Engineer

    2 weeks ago


    New York, New York, United States Triveni IT Full time

    Position Overview: Triveni IT is seeking a talented software engineer to enhance our development team, focusing on .Net, C#, JavaScript, SQL, and associated technologies across Mobile, Web, and Desktop environments. This role involves crafting high-quality software architecture, managing tasks throughout the software development lifecycle, and collaborating...


  • New York, New York, United States Georgia IT Inc Full time

    Position: Senior C++ Software Engineer Location: New York City, NY Duration: Contract Rate: DOE Overview We are seeking a skilled Senior C++ Software Engineer to join our dynamic team at Georgia IT Inc. This role involves leveraging your expertise in C++ and Python, particularly in Object Oriented Programming with a focus on analytics, to contribute to...


  • New York, New York, United States GQR Full time

    This position is for a Lead C++ Software Developer who will focus on advanced software engineering practices.The ideal candidate will possess a deep understanding of low latency order management systems, smart order routing, and C++ FIX connectivity.This role involves collaborating within a technology-driven team alongside portfolio managers and traders to...

  • C++ Software Engineer

    2 weeks ago


    New York, New York, United States QUANTEAM - North America (RAINBOW PARTNERS Group) Full time

    Company OverviewAs a key player in the consulting landscape, Quanteam operates under the umbrella of RAINBOW PARTNERS, focusing on Banking, Finance, and Financial Services. Our ethos revolves around values such as collaboration, diversity, and excellence, with a workforce of 1,000 consultants from 35 nationalities across 10 global offices.Position OverviewWe...

  • C++ Software Engineer

    2 weeks ago


    New York, New York, United States QUANTEAM - North America (RAINBOW PARTNERS Group) Full time

    Company OverviewQuanteam, a pivotal entity within RAINBOW PARTNERS, is a consulting firm dedicated to the realms of Banking, Finance, and Financial Services. Our ethos revolves around core values such as collaboration, diversity, and excellence, embodied by our team of 1,000 skilled consultants from 35 nationalities, operating across 10 global...


  • New York, New York, United States QUANTEAM - North America (RAINBOW PARTNERS Group) Full time

    Company OverviewAs a pioneering entity within RAINBOW PARTNERS, Quanteam is a consultancy firm focused on Banking, Finance, and Financial Services. Our ethos is built on values such as collaboration, diversity, and excellence, with a team of 1,000 skilled consultants from 35 nationalities operating across 10 global offices.Position OverviewOur client is in...


  • New York, New York, United States QUANTEAM - North America (RAINBOW PARTNERS Group) Full time

    Company OverviewAs a pivotal entity within RAINBOW PARTNERS, Quanteam operates as a consulting firm focused on Banking, Finance, and Financial Services. Our ethos is driven by values such as collaboration, diversity, and excellence, with a team of 1,000 skilled consultants from 35 nationalities working across 10 global offices.Position OverviewOur client is...


  • New York, New York, United States Open Systems Technologies Full time

    Position OverviewOpen Systems Technologies is seeking a talented C++ Software Engineer to enhance our dynamic team. This role is essential for driving innovative solutions in a fast-paced environment.CompensationSalary Range: $175,000 - $200,000QualificationsBachelor's degree in Computer Science or a related discipline.A minimum of 8 years of robust software...


  • New York, New York, United States Brains Workgroup, Inc. Full time

    Position Overview:Brains Workgroup, Inc. is seeking a skilled C++ Software Engineering Consultant to join our team. This role offers a hybrid work arrangement, allowing for a combination of in-office and remote work.Contract Details:This is a contract position with a duration of 6 months, with the potential for extensions or a transition to a permanent...


  • New York, New York, United States LaBine and Associates Full time

    Job OverviewPosition: Software Engineer - C# WPFWe are currently seeking candidates for a full-time role focused on Front-End development utilizing C# and WPF within an MVVM architecture.Our organization specializes in the design, development, and maintenance of advanced trading solutions. The end-user experience is paramount, particularly for institutional...


  • New York, New York, United States Focus Capital Markets Full time

    We are seeking highly skilled C++ Developers to join our team at Focus Capital Markets. As a key member of our technology team, you will be responsible for designing, developing, and maintaining our trading software.Key Responsibilities:Design and implement efficient and scalable C++ code for our trading platformCollaborate with cross-functional teams to...


  • New York, New York, United States Brains Workgroup Full time

    Brains Workgroup is seeking a talented C++ Software Engineer Consultant to join our dynamic team. This position offers a hybrid work model, allowing for flexibility between office and remote work.This is a contract opportunity with potential for extensions or a transition to a permanent role.** Candidates must have authorization to work for any employer in...


  • New York, New York, United States Compunnel Inc. Full time

    Position: C++ Software Engineer - Trading SolutionsLocation: Jersey City (local candidates preferred)Team Overview: The Fidelity Digital Asset Trading Team is tasked with developing platform services and APIs that facilitate cryptocurrency trading.The platform features a crossing engine and a smart routing system designed to connect and transmit client...


  • New York, New York, United States Motion Recruitment Full time

    Position Overview: A leading SaaS communications and trading platform organization is seeking to onboard several Senior-Level C#/.NET Engineers to enhance their growing team. This firm specializes in innovative software solutions tailored for financial experts, providing comprehensive tools for account management, trading reporting, and analytics within a...

  • C++ Software Engineer

    2 weeks ago


    New York, New York, United States QUANTEAM - North America (RAINBOW PARTNERS Group) Full time

    Company OverviewQuanteam, a pivotal entity within RAINBOW PARTNERS, is a consulting firm dedicated to the domains of Banking, Finance, and Financial Services. Our organization thrives on the principles of collaboration, diversity, and excellence, with a team of 1,000 skilled consultants hailing from 35 different nationalities, operating across 10...